IPL 2016
A season of records and drama, IPL 2016 concluded with Sunrisers Hyderabad lifting the trophy. The tournament showcased the best of T20 cricket across 60 games, with fans treated to 18862 runs in total.

Batting Brilliance
The battle for the Orange Cap was intense, with V Kohli eventually claiming the honor with 973 runs. The season saw batters dominate, hitting a total of 7 centuries and 110 half-centuries. AB de Villiers produced the innings of the tournament with a magnificent 129 off just 53 balls.

Bowling Mastery
On the bowling front, B Kumar was the standout performer, taking home the Purple Cap with 24 wickets. Spinners and pacers alike found their moments, contributing to a total of 666 wickets falling throughout the tournament.

Season Highlights
The season featured 639 maximums and 1633 boundaries, entertaining crowds across all venues. From nail-biting finishes to dominant team performances, IPL 2016 added another thrilling chapter to the league's history.
